Similar issue just started. 2011 Base 4cyl FWD with only 11,000 miles. Hitting any road roughness, bridge straps, dips or cracks, especially when on a slight curve (we're talking highway curves - very slight) the front end will bounce the front wheels and sometimes I feel the rear ones as well, maybe 5 or 6 times rapidly. Reminds me of an old Pontiac I had with completely shot suspension and worn out shocks. The nose also porpoises and the car will even skip sideways sometimes toward the outside of the curve. Will happen at any speed over 30 or so. Don't see much about this on the web, can't believe shocks are worn out so soon. Will give the dealer an opportunity to correct, although I don't expect much having had previous Toyotas.
